A Member of the House of Representatives, Akoko North East/ North West Federal Constituency, Olubunmi Tunji-Ojo, popularly known as BTO, has been declared the winner of the just concluded House of Representatives election in the Federal Constituency.
BTO also becomes the first incumbent federal lawmaker from the area to win re-election in the history of the federal constituency.
BTO won Reelection With Unprecedented Votes below;
APC 51532 (84.5%)
PDP 9014 (14.8%).

Otunba Adegboyega Adefarati of the APC in Akoko South West/South East Federal Constituency has won the Reps seat.
Gboyega also made history as the first son of former governor in Ondo State to win elective position in the state.
Akoko South West/South East Federal Constituency Election Results.
House of Representatives
APC 25,874
PDP 18,403
SDP 4,560.
